    [b]THE LOUIS VUITTON II WATCH

    A much simpler and smaller quartz timepiece, also designed by Aulenti and manufactured by IWC, is the LV-II travel watch which has an alarm function that can be used as a reminder of an appointment, telephone calls or departure. Its case is in zirconium oxide, a ceramic chosen for its exceptional resistance. It neither scratches nor tarnishes. Totally impervious to water and anti-magnetic, the case came in black or green with a sapphire crystal.

    Both above mentioned timepieces are remarkable achievements of two companies widely recognized and highly respected for their innovative accomplishments in their own fields. Thus, the purpose of this review is only to illustrate to watch enthusiasts these masterpieces which take a special place in the history of watchmaking.[/b]
